aktueller Standort:Heim > Technische Artikel > tägliche Programmierung > PHP-Kenntnisse

  • Laravel Wenn geladen - Leistungsoptimierung durch das Laden der bedingten Beziehung
    Laravel Wenn geladen - Leistungsoptimierung durch das Laden der bedingten Beziehung
    Die API -Ressourcenfunktionalität von Laravel kann zugeordneten Daten in der API -Reaktion bedingt einbeziehen, wodurch die Leistung optimiert wird, indem unnötige Datenbankabfragen verhindert werden. Hier ist ein Beispiel für die Verwendung der WHOLOLDED () -Methode:
    PHP-Tutorial . Backend-Entwicklung 1024 2025-03-06 02:03:08
  • Filterungsobjekte nach Typ mit wherinstance of filtern
    Filterungsobjekte nach Typ mit wherinstance of filtern
    Die Laravel -Methode bietet eine prägnante Möglichkeit, Sammlungen basierend auf Objekttypen zu filtern, was besonders nützlich ist, wenn es um polymorphe Beziehungen oder gemischte Objektsammlungen geht. Hier finden Sie ein einfaches Beispiel, das zeigt, wie Sie eine Sammlung filtern, die Benutzer- und Postobjekte mithilfe von WHOINSTANCEOF filtert:
    PHP-Tutorial . Backend-Entwicklung 440 2025-03-06 02:02:08
  • Holen Sie sich Xdebug in einer Minute mit Docker und Php 8.4 zusammenarbeiten
    Holen Sie sich Xdebug in einer Minute mit Docker und Php 8.4 zusammenarbeiten
    Xdebug hat in der Vergangenheit eine steile Lernkurve für Setups. Ich bin hier, um Ihnen zu zeigen, dass das Einrichten von XDebug nicht schmerzhaft sein muss. Tatsächlich bin ich zuversichtlich, dass Sie in etwa einer Minute XDEBUG mit Docker verwenden können. Ok, vielleicht dauert es etwas o
    PHP-Tutorial . Backend-Entwicklung 948 2025-03-06 02:01:17
  • Verwalten von API -Ratenlimits in Laravel durch Job -Drosselung
    Verwalten von API -Ratenlimits in Laravel durch Job -Drosselung
    Effizientes Verwalten von API -Ratengrenzen ist bei der Integration in externe Dienste wie AWS SES für die E -Mail -Zustellung von entscheidender Bedeutung. Laravel bietet eine optimierte Lösung mit Redis :: Drossel
    PHP-Tutorial . Backend-Entwicklung 428 2025-03-06 01:44:08
  • Dynamische API -Reaktionskontrolle in Laravel -Ressourcen
    Dynamische API -Reaktionskontrolle in Laravel -Ressourcen
    Laravel -API -Ressourcen bieten elegante Möglichkeiten, um bedingte Eigenschaften in Antworten einzubeziehen, sodass Sie flexible und effiziente APIs erstellen können, die unterschiedliche Kontexte und Berechtigungen entsprechen. Beim Erstellen von APIs müssen Sie Ihre Antworten häufig anhand verschiedener Szenarien anpassen - beispielsweise nur bestimmte Felder an Ihren Administrator, einschließlich nur relevanter Daten, oder wenn Sie das Antwortformat basierend auf Endpunkten anpassen. Die API -Ressourcen von Laravel bieten eine leistungsstarke Möglichkeit, diese Situationen durch bedingte Eigenschaften zu bewältigen. Einige wichtige Methoden sind: Wenn (): enthält Attribute nur, wenn die Bedingung wahr ist WHOLADED (): Enthält die Beziehung nur, wenn sie geladen ist Whennotnull (): Nur wenn die Eigenschaft nicht ist
    PHP-Tutorial . Backend-Entwicklung 241 2025-03-06 01:42:13
  • Straffungsroutenparameter in Laravel unter Verwendung von URL -Standardeinstellungen
    Straffungsroutenparameter in Laravel unter Verwendung von URL -Standardeinstellungen
    Das Verwalten von URL -Parametern in Laravel -Anwendungen, insbesondere in mehreren Sprachen oder komplexen Routing -Mustern, kann sich wiederholt. Laravel bietet eine elegante Lösung über URL-Standardeinstellungen, sodass Sie die anwendungsweite Standard-VA festlegen können
    PHP-Tutorial . Backend-Entwicklung 466 2025-03-06 01:41:09
  • So erstellen Sie Ihr erstes PHP -Paket
    So erstellen Sie Ihr erstes PHP -Paket
    Möchten Sie ein PHP -Paket von Grund auf neu erstellen und es mit anderen PHP -Entwicklern teilen? Der Komponist, dieses Abhängigkeitsmanagement -Tool, macht diesen Prozess einfach! Dank des Komponisten hat PHP eines der Top -Paketökosysteme. Schauen wir uns einen tieferen Blick darauf an, wie PHP -Pakete Schritt für Schritt erstellen. Fangen an Dieser Artikel richtet sich hauptsächlich an PHP -Neulinge (oder PHP -Paket -Schreibanfänger) und zielt darauf ab, ihnen zu helfen, wie man PHP -Pakete von Grund auf neu erstellt. Das Erstellen eines neuen PHP -Pakets erfordert die folgenden Aufgaben: Initialisieren Sie das Git -Repository Erstellen und konfigurieren Sie Composer.json -Dateien Abhängigkeiten installieren Richten Sie die automatische Belastung ein Obwohl wir zuerst ein leeres Github -Projekt erstellen können und es gram
    PHP-Tutorial . Backend-Entwicklung 680 2025-03-06 01:38:08
  • Aufzündete Routenberechtigungen in Laravel
    Aufzündete Routenberechtigungen in Laravel
    Laravel vereinfacht nun die Berechtigungsüberprüfung beim Routing durch Hinzufügen von Enumerationsunterstützung direkt in der CAN () -Methode. Diese Verbesserung beseitigt die Notwendigkeit, explizit auf die Wertattribute der Aufzählung zugreifen zu können, wodurch die Routing -Definition einfacher und ausdrucksvoller wird. Diese Funktion ist besonders großartig, wenn Sie Administrator-Panels oder Multi-Mieter-Anwendungen erstellen, bei denen das Berechtigungsmanagement von entscheidender Bedeutung ist und Sie die Sicherheitsfunktionen von PHP nutzen möchten. Route :: get ('/admin', function () { // ... })-> Can (Berechtigung :: Access_admin); Hier finden Sie die Grundlagen im Administratorfeld
    PHP-Tutorial . Backend-Entwicklung 875 2025-03-06 01:37:08
  • Extrahieren von sequentiellen Daten mit Laravels Take the Take Take
    Extrahieren von sequentiellen Daten mit Laravels Take the Take Take
    Laravels TakeInt -Methode bietet eine präzise Kontrolle über die Sammelfilterung. Es extrahiert aufeinanderfolgende Elemente, die eine bestimmte Bedingung erfüllen, und stoppt am ersten Element, das die Bedingung fehlschlägt. Dieses Beispiel zeigt die Extraktion der aufsteigenden Zahl
    PHP-Tutorial . Backend-Entwicklung 936 2025-03-06 01:34:13
  • Intelligente Routenerkennung in Laravel
    Intelligente Routenerkennung in Laravel
    Das elegante Routensystem von Laravel bietet eine saubere Lösung, um festzustellen, ob die aktuelle Anforderung mit einer bestimmten Route übereinstimmt. Diese leistungsstarke Funktion ermöglicht eine bedingte Logik, die auf der aktiven Route basiert und ideal für Aufgaben wie Analyseverfolgung, Dynam
    PHP-Tutorial . Backend-Entwicklung 682 2025-03-06 01:32:09
  • Konvertieren von Laravel -Modellen in JSON für API -Antworten in JSON konvertieren
    Konvertieren von Laravel -Modellen in JSON für API -Antworten in JSON konvertieren
    Laravel bietet verschiedene Methoden zur Umwandlung eloquenter Modelle in JSON, wobei Tojson () einer der einfachsten Ansätze ist. Diese Methode bietet Flexibilität darin, wie Ihre Modelle für API -Antworten serialisiert werden. // Grundnutzung von Tojson (
    PHP-Tutorial . Backend-Entwicklung 339 2025-03-06 01:17:13
  • Verbesserung der Datenverarbeitung mit Laravels Transform () -Methode
    Verbesserung der Datenverarbeitung mit Laravels Transform () -Methode
    Die Transformation () -Helferfunktion von Laravel bietet einen optimierten Ansatz zur Verwaltung bedingter Datenmodifikationen, insbesondere nützlich, wenn es um potenziell Nullwerte geht. Dieses Tutorial untersucht seine Funktionalität und demonstriert seine Anwendung I.
    PHP-Tutorial . Backend-Entwicklung 397 2025-03-06 01:08:17
  • Interaktive Konsolenbefehle in Laravel
    Interaktive Konsolenbefehle in Laravel
    Beim Erstellen von Befehlszeilen-Tools in Laravel besteht eine der häufigsten Herausforderungen darin, fehlende oder falsche Benutzereingaben anmutig zu behandeln. Laravels Eingabeaufforderungformissinginput -Merkmal befasst
    PHP-Tutorial . Backend-Entwicklung 501 2025-03-06 01:06:11
  • Erzeugen von sequentiellen Laravel -Sammlungen
    Erzeugen von sequentiellen Laravel -Sammlungen
    Wenn Sie eine Sammlung mit einer bestimmten Anzahl berechneter Elemente erstellen müssen, bietet die Zeitmethode von Laravel eine elegante Lösung. Diese Methode ist besonders nützlich, um Sequenzen, Zeitfenster, Paginierungsverbindungen oder Szenarienanforderungen zu erzeugen
    PHP-Tutorial . Backend-Entwicklung 567 2025-03-06 01:02:12

Werkzeugempfehlungen

Kontaktcode für das jQuery-Enterprise-Nachrichtenformular

Der Kontaktcode für das jQuery-Unternehmensnachrichtenformular ist ein einfacher und praktischer Unternehmensnachrichtenformular- und Kontaktcode für die Einführungsseite.

Wiedergabeeffekte für HTML5-MP3-Spieluhren

Der Spezialeffekt „HTML5 MP3-Musikbox-Wiedergabe“ ist ein MP3-Musikplayer, der auf HTML5+CSS3 basiert, um niedliche Musikbox-Emoticons zu erstellen und auf die Schaltfläche „Umschalten“ zu klicken.

HTML5 coole Partikelanimations-Navigationsmenü-Spezialeffekte

Der Spezialeffekt „HTML5 Cool Particle Animation“ für das Navigationsmenü ist ein Spezialeffekt, der seine Farbe ändert, wenn die Maus über das Navigationsmenü bewegt wird.
Menünavigation
2024-02-29

Drag-and-Drop-Bearbeitungscode für visuelle jQuery-Formulare

Der Drag-and-Drop-Bearbeitungscode für visuelle jQuery-Formulare ist eine visuelle Form, die auf jQuery und dem Bootstrap-Framework basiert.

Webvorlage für Bio-Obst- und Gemüselieferanten Bootstrap5

Eine Webvorlage für Bio-Obst- und Gemüselieferanten – Bootstrap5
Bootstrap-Vorlage
2023-02-03

Bootstrap3 multifunktionale Dateninformations-Hintergrundverwaltung, responsive Webseitenvorlage – Novus

Bootstrap3 multifunktionale Dateninformations-Hintergrundverwaltung, responsive Webseitenvorlage – Novus
Backend-Vorlage
2023-02-02

Webseitenvorlage für die Immobilienressourcen-Serviceplattform Bootstrap5

Webseitenvorlage für die Immobilienressourcen-Serviceplattform Bootstrap5
Bootstrap-Vorlage
2023-02-02

Einfache Webvorlage für Lebenslaufinformationen Bootstrap4

Einfache Webvorlage für Lebenslaufinformationen Bootstrap4
Bootstrap-Vorlage
2023-02-02

可爱的夏天元素矢量素材(EPS+PNG)

这是一款可爱的夏天元素矢量素材,包含了太阳、遮阳帽、椰子树、比基尼、飞机、西瓜、冰淇淋、雪糕、冷饮、游泳圈、人字拖、菠萝、海螺、贝壳、海星、螃蟹、柠檬、防晒霜、太阳镜等等,素材提供了 EPS 和免扣 PNG 两种格式,含 JPG 预览图。
PNG material
2024-05-09

四个红的的 2023 毕业徽章矢量素材(AI+EPS+PNG)

这是一款红的的 2023 毕业徽章矢量素材,共四个,提供了 AI 和 EPS 和免扣 PNG 等格式,含 JPG 预览图。
PNG material
2024-02-29

唱歌的小鸟和装满花朵的推车设计春天banner矢量素材(AI+EPS)

这是一款由唱歌的小鸟和装满花朵的推车设计的春天 banner 矢量素材,提供了 AI 和 EPS 两种格式,含 JPG 预览图。
Banner image
2024-02-29

金色的毕业帽矢量素材(EPS+PNG)

这是一款金色的毕业帽矢量素材,提供了 EPS 和免扣 PNG 两种格式,含 JPG 预览图。
PNG material
2024-02-27

Website-Vorlage für Reinigungs- und Reparaturdienste für Inneneinrichtungen

Die Website-Vorlage für Reinigungs- und Wartungsdienste für Heimdekoration ist ein Website-Vorlagen-Download, der sich für Werbewebsites eignet, die Heimdekorations-, Reinigungs-, Wartungs- und andere Dienstleistungsorganisationen anbieten.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-05-09

Persönliche Lebenslauf-Leitfaden-Seitenvorlage in frischen Farben

Die Vorlage „Fresh Color Matching“ für die Lebenslauf-Leitfadenseite für persönliche Bewerbungen ist eine persönliche Webvorlage zum Herunterladen von Lebensläufen für die Jobsuche, die für einen frischen Farbabstimmungsstil geeignet ist.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-29

Web-Vorlage für kreativen Job-Lebenslauf für Designer

Die Webvorlage „Designer Creative Job Resume“ ist eine herunterladbare Webvorlage für die Anzeige persönlicher Lebensläufe, die für verschiedene Designerpositionen geeignet ist.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-28

Website-Vorlage eines modernen Ingenieurbauunternehmens

Die Website-Vorlage für moderne Ingenieur- und Bauunternehmen ist eine herunterladbare Website-Vorlage, die sich zur Förderung der Ingenieur- und Baudienstleistungsbranche eignet. Tipp: Diese Vorlage ruft die Google-Schriftartenbibliothek auf und die Seite wird möglicherweise langsam geöffnet.
Frontend-Vorlage
2024-02-28